We enjoyed (is that the right word?) our holiday-themed commentary for One Magic Christmas (you know...the one were the dad gets shot. in. the. face.) so much we decided to do another one!
2020 was a weird year, and it produced an even weirder Santa Claus movie: Fatman, Starring Mel Gibson as Santa (you read that right). Only Frank has seen this one beforehand, so we're all in for a treat. Hit up Peacock, rent it on the Blockbusters of the Internet, settle in with some booze and tag along for this wonky sleigh ride.
